"🧵🪡" represents the art of stitchery, combining the visual simplicity of a spool of thread (🧵) with the functional precision of a sewing needle (🪡). It symbolizes the intricate craft of sewing and embroidery, where skilled hands bring together fabrics and threads to create beautiful and meaningful creations.
